Sirius Black was an important positive character in the Harry Potter series, while Voldemort was the main villain. Sirius was a close friend of the Potters and a member of the Order of the Phoenix. He was brave, loyal, and rebellious. James Potter regarded him as a close friend and became Harry Potter's godfather. Voldemort was the leader of the Death Eaters, the pureblood organization of the Extreme Wizards. He was known as the most dangerous Dark Wizard in history. Sirius's cousin, Bellatrix Lestrange, was one of Voldemort's most loyal Death Eaters. Sirius was wrongly imprisoned in Azkaban, escaped from prison and continued to fight Voldemort and his Death Eaters, and eventually died under Bellatrix's Reaper Curse. Voldemort, on the other hand, fought against the forces of justice such as Harry Potter throughout the story. He wanted to rule the Wizarding world, creating many horrors and triggering wars. In the original Harry Potter series, Sirius was not Voldemort. Sirius was Harry Potter's godfather, a Gryffindor graduate, and a righteous adversary to Voldemort. Voldemort, originally named Tom Marvolo Riddle, was a villain who attempted to rule the Wizarding world and committed many evil acts. There might be some special settings in some derivative works or niche interpretation, but according to the orthodox setting of Harry Potter, Sirius and Voldemort were two completely different characters.
